Dingle Court is in Ranskill, Retford and in Bassetlaw district. DN22 8FB is located in the Ranskill elect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Bassetlaw. This postcode has been in use since 2004-11-01.

Safety

Is Dingle Court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Dingle Court was 35.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 11.3% lower than the Everton average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Dingle Court has the 4th lowest crime rate of 21 local areas in Everton and the 118th lowest crime rate of 384 local areas in Bassetlaw .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 14.8 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-45.6%.
